The decision to pursue a Pre-Engineering Degree from Cerro Coso Community College can yield significant returns on investment (ROI) for students looking to enter the dynamic fields of engineering and technology. With a curriculum designed to equip students with the foundational skills necessary for success in advanced engineering studies, this program prepares graduates for a variety of career pathways.

One of the primary benefits of earning a Pre-Engineering Degree is the cost-effectiveness of attending a community college. Tuition rates at Cerro Coso are generally lower than those at four-year institutions, allowing students to save money while receiving a quality education. Additionally, the college offers flexible course schedules, enabling students to balance their studies with work or other commitments.

Graduates with a Pre-Engineering Degree can transition to a bachelor's program in engineering, leading to higher earning potential. According to industry data, individuals with a bachelor's degree in engineering can earn an average salary significantly higher than those with only a high school diploma or an associate degree. This potential for increased income represents a strong ROI for students making the initial investment in their education.

Furthermore, the skills acquired through the Pre-Engineering program—such as mathematics, physics, and problem-solving—are highly sought after in various industries, including aerospace, civil engineering, and computer science. This demand translates into robust job opportunities for graduates, further enhancing the value of their educational investment.

In summary, the Pre-Engineering Degree from Cerro Coso Community College offers a strategic pathway for students to achieve their career goals while maximizing their return on investment. By choosing an affordable, quality education, students can set themselves up for long-term success in the engineering field.
